This is my set-up for blade disposal.
It is an empty tin can of Milk about 6 inches high.
I'm new to wet shaving, so I don't know how long it will take to fill this can, but I'm guessing more than 2 years atleast.
I cut a long hole with my safety knife saw and then put Araldite sealant to eliminate any sharp edges.
This is kept in the lower drawer of almirah and everyone in my home knows that it contains discarded blades.
It'll be given to the junk yard/ recycling shop for free of cost where he will melt it to reuse.
